Safe Handling and Storage

Cadmium Nanopowder is toxic and requires cautious handling within controlled environments. Store the material in cool, dry places under an inert atmosphere to maintain stability and reduce exposure risk. Available vacuum-sealed packaging ensures safety during storage and transport.
